Understanding Country Codes and Their Significance

Before delving into the specifics of 00201 country code, it’s crucial to understand the fundamental role of country codes in the global telecommunications network.

Purpose: Country codes are numerical prefixes assigned to each country to facilitate international calls. They enable the seamless routing of calls across different networks and geographical boundaries.
Structure: Valid country codes typically consist of one to three digits, assigned by the International Telecommunication Union (ITU).
Importance: Country codes are essential for establishing connections between callers and recipients in different countries, ensuring that calls reach their intended destinations.

Correct Country Code for Egypt: +20

If you intend to make a call to Egypt, the correct country code to use is +20. This code is internationally recognized and will ensure that your call is routed correctly to the desired destination within Egypt.

Practical Tips for Avoiding Country Code Confusion

Verify Country Codes: Always double-check the correct country code before making an international call. You can refer to reliable online resources or consult your telephone service provider for accurate information.
Use the Plus (+) Sign: When dialing international numbers, use the plus (+) sign followed by the country code and the phone number. This will automatically convert to the correct international access code for your location.
Be Mindful of Auto-Formatting: Be aware that some apps may automatically add prefixes when dialing international numbers. If you see “00” added before the country code, remove it if you’re already using the correct international access code.
